Just before the long holiday weekend, blind Willie and his family came back for a wonderful visit with us. Katie G. adopted Willie the Beagle in June 2007, a few days after getting married. She and her new husband, Greg, picked up Willie on their way to Twentynine Palms, California, where Greg was stationed with the U.S. Marine Corps. Katie had been a volunteer at the ranch and that’s how she came to know Willie, who was a very timid soul at the time.
In the past year, Katie and Greg had an adorable baby girl, Jacky, who you see on Katie’s lap in the photo. (Greg is currently serving in Iraq and hasn’t seen his daughter yet!) Also in the photo is Zeus, a dog who Greg rescued a few years ago. Another soldier had owned Zeus and was trying to turn him into a fighting dog — by beating him and then starving him. Greg saved Zeus from this terrible situation, although it took a long time for Zeus to even trust Greg. Katie said that for the first few months, Zeus would hide in the bedroom and whenever Greg would walk by the door, Zeus would begin urinating submissively out of fear.
To this day Zeus is afraid of other men, Katie says, though she was surprised to see Zeus immediately warm up to me. While I was sitting on the floor in the welcome center, Zeus walked right over, licked me in the face, and then laid down next to me. Katie was astonished and said, "I’ve never seen him do that!" (It’s the beard, I tell you.)
Interestingly enough, that’s how it was with Willie and Katie. Willie would slink from most people, but whenever he would hear Katie’s voice on our volunteer days, his tail would go up and he would start running in circles, baying. It was if he were announcing, "Katie’s coming! Katie’s coming!"
Willie has blossomed into the perfect family pet and has really come out of his shell. In fact, he’s become the family protector of sorts! When big Zeus gets afraid, he goes and hides behind Willie. Katie says that whenever Jacky is upset and cries, Willie starts baying to let Katie know something’s wrong with the baby. And when Jacky is getting her bath, Willie whines and barks as if something isn’t quite right about that, either — maybe it’s how he feels about getting his own bath?
Willie’s favorite thing, Katie reports, is going for a ride in the baby stroller! While Jacky rides up above in the main compartment, Willie loves to sit underneath in the sling. And that’s how Katie takes them all for a walk … Zeus on a leash and Jacky and Willie in the baby stroller.
Willie has come a long way, and bless Katie and Greg for taking this boy into their lives. We’re wishing for Greg’s safe and speedy return home to his family!
